Output 8e591d390a1f8e6a1b4195cb76ab4b82f67ed5f331e5c7308871d8679bf85e39:0

value
24923883
script pubkey
OP_0 OP_PUSHBYTES_20 9037f27830c987ce87b9994ead372ffcb466a770
address
bc1qjqmly7psexruapaen9826de0lj6xdfmsdr372q
transaction
8e591d390a1f8e6a1b4195cb76ab4b82f67ed5f331e5c7308871d8679bf85e39
confirmations
63606
spent
true